This patch ignores any arguments that isn't of Map type during the invocation of a Map collection. Based on the supported data-structures, these non-Map arguments can either be of type int (capacity, loadFactor) or Comparator. The use case for the latter is not currently supported while the former have no equivalent in javascript. Fixes #508
